Freezing Point Tester LLTT-A25 operates with a cooling bath temperature range of -80℃ to 20℃ and delivers high accuracy of ±0.1℃. It features fully automated detection of cooling, stirring, heating, and crystallization, significantly improving testing efficiency. The system incorporates a self-developed big data curve model for automatic crystallization temperature detection. Designed in accordance with ASTM D2386, this tester ensures precise measurement of the freezing point of aviation fuels.
Applications:
Our freezing point tester helps identify the temperature at which solid hydrocarbon crystals may begin to form in aviation turbine fuels and gasoline. It is applicable in aviation, automotive, and chemical manufacturing.
